| Remarks | The scheme is technically valid provided the reference laboratory's CMC is at least three times better than the participant's claimed uncertainty; otherwise the discriminating power of En is weak. Traceability of the artefact (standard resistor, DC voltage source, multifunction calibrator, or transfer standard) must be unbroken to SI, with documented drift history and stability during circulation. Environmental influence quantities — temperature, humidity, thermal EMF, self-heating, lead resistance, loading effect, and connection technique — must be recorded, as these dominate the error budget in DC/LF electrical measurement. Uncertainty budgets submitted by participants should be reviewed for completeness; an unsatisfactory En often arises from understated uncertainty rather than measurement bias. The single-laboratory approach is acceptable under ISO/IEC 17043 and satisfies ILAC-P9 requirements for participation, but it does not provide the peer-group comparison of a full round-robin, so conclusions are limited to bilateral agreement with the reference laboratory.The scheme is fit for purpose for demonstrating measurement competence and traceability in electrical parameters, subject to satisfactory En values and a robust reference laboratory uncertainty claim.
